Will Mike Tyson lose his fight with drugs and alcohol?

Former undisputed heavyweight world champion Mike Tyson claims he is on the verge of dying from ongoing drug and alcohol problems.

47 year old Tyson admitted he is a continual substance abuser but added he is hopeful of finally getting clean.

At the age of 20, in 1987, the American fighter held the record as the youngest boxer to win the WBC, WBA and IBF heavyweight titles.

But five years later Brooklyn-born Tyson was convicted of raping Desiree Washington and sentenced to six years in prison.

He returned to the ring but retired from the sport in 2006 and in 2007 was sentenced to 24 hours in jail and 360 hours of community service for drug possession and driving under the influence.
